Melksham Food and River Festival
The Melksham Food and River Festival is a vibrant, free community event held annually on the last weekend in August at King George V Playing Field and along the River Avon. Organised by the Festival Committee with support from the Wilts & Berks Canal Trust and Wiltshire Youth Canoe Club, the festival celebrates local culture, community spirit, and riverside heritage.
The event showcases a wide array of local food and drink producers, artisans, and start-up businesses, offering visitors the chance to sample and purchase high-quality local goods. With activities and entertainment for all ages—including canoeing, river displays, community group exhibitions, and live music—the festival is a must-visit summer highlight for families and visitors from across the region.
